A series of coordinated attacks on religious institutions unfolded Sunday evening across the North Caucasus region, specifically in Russia's Dagestan Republic and the self-declared state of Abkhazia. The Israeli Foreign Ministry confirmed that no Jewish worshippers were present in the attacked synagogue, and no Israeli or Jewish casualties were reported. The violence began when […]

Russia's Internal Affairs Ministry said a synagogue and a church in Derbent were set on fire, but no Jewish or Israeli casualties are known. According to Russian media, gun battles continue in Derbent and Makhachkala between the police and the attackers, believed to be supporters of an international terrorist organization
